1. 收益:(1) 收益(Revenue)是指出售產(chǎn)品所得到的收入,即價格與銷售量的乘積. 收益中包括了成本與利潤. 收益函數(shù)表示收益是銷售量的函數(shù). 因為收益取決于價格和銷售量,而價格取決于市場對該產(chǎn)品的需求,在市場均衡時,市場的需求量應(yīng)等于銷售量.

☆ 1433年進入英語,直接源自古法語的revenue;最初源自拉丁語的revenire,意為回歸。
